Transaction d08fc3c3915152333362f87f301c11d3cc46d945efa41abf34e94651cd01f232
1 Input
1 Output
-
d08fc3c3915152333362f87f301c11d3cc46d945efa41abf34e94651cd01f232:0
- value
- 338085
- script pubkey
- OP_0 OP_PUSHBYTES_20 9153cc520361df144dd7b0038147561dff06c685
- address
- bc1qj9fuc5srv803gnwhkqpcz36krhlsd359m6ma2r